    What is Dr. Kelly Jeu's specialty?

    Dr. Jeu is a Pediatrician near Loma Linda, CA. A pediatrician focuses on the physical, emotional, and social health of children from birth through young adulthood. Their care includes a wide range of health services, from preventive healthcare to diagnosing and treating acute and chronic diseases. Pediatricians consider the biological, social, and environmental influences on a child's development, as well as how diseases and dysfunctions can impact growth and overall development.
